Depending on where you're coming from, your flight to Arawak Cay could be completely painless or it could go on forever. Here are some tips that will help you start your next unforgettable escape on a positive note. What to pack in your hand luggage:
- The trick to having a stress-free travel experience is to pack in advance. Start with the essentials: passport, travel docs, cash and vital medications. Next, bring items that'll help keep you occupied, like some electronic devices or a good book. It's also a wise idea to bring your chargers, a neck pillow and a pair of noise-cancelling headphones. Last but not least, be sure to toss in toiletries like a toothbrush, deodorant and a fresh change of clothes.
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:
- Make sure you don't have a sharp object lurking in one of the compartments of your carry-on luggage. Other banned items include flammable or explosive products, such as fuel and matches, and liquids and gels in containers larger than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res).
What to wear on a flight:
- Comfort should be your highest priority when deciding what to wear on your flight. Loose, breathable clothing is a smart option, as are flat, slightly roomy shoes.
- De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clot condition caused by lengthy periods of inactivity, can be a risk on long-haul flights. Walk around the cabin and give your legs a stretch or do some gentle exercises in your seat to promote better circulation.
